CVE-2008-0630
MPlayer 1.0rc2 and SVN before r25823 - Buffer Overflow via URL Parsing
Title source: llmDescription
Buffer overflow in url.c in MPlayer 1.0rc2 and SVN before r25823 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ted URL that prevents the IPv6 parsing code from setting a pointer to NULL, which causes the buffer to be reused by the unescape code.
